CENTRO PARA EL DESARROLLO AGROECOLOGICO Y AGROINDUSTRIAL REGIONAL ATLANTICO. SABANA LARGA. INSTRUCTOR: RAFAEL ALEXANDER SALTARIN TEJERA ESTUDIANTE: KAREN ANDREA BENAVIDES GARCIA TEMA: TALLER DE RESOLUCIÓN DE PROBLEMAS DE ALGORITMOS EN PSEUDOCÓDIGO Y DIAGRAMAS DE FLUJO FICHA: 2758250 PROGRAMA: ANALISIS Y DESARROLLO DE SOFTWARE FECHA: 03 / OCTUBRE/ 2023 MODALIDAD VIRTUAL 1. Se desea elaborar un algoritmo que permita identificar la cantidad de dólares equivalentes a una cantidad de pesos colombianos Para precisar los elementos de entrada de cada una de las situaciones enunciadas no olvide las preguntas guía: ¿Qué información es importante y necesaria para resolver el problema? La tasa de cambio actual entre el dólar y el peso colombiano es esencial. La cantidad de pesos colombianos que se desea convertir a dólares. ¿Qué información no es importante y se puede prescindir? No es necesario conocer detalles adicionales, como la fecha de la transacción, a menos que la tasa de cambio varíe significativamente en un corto período de tiempo. ¿Cuáles son los datos de entrada conocidos? La tasa de cambio actual entre el dólar y el peso colombiano (por ejemplo, 1 dólar = X pesos colombianos). La cantidad de pesos colombianos que se desea convertir. ¿Cuál es la incógnita o qué debemos calcular? La cantidad equivalente en dólares. ¿Los datos se pueden agrupar en categorías? Sí, los datos se pueden dividir en dos categorías principales: la tasa de cambio (un valor constante) y la cantidad de pesos colombianos (un valor que puede variar). ¿Qué información adicional hace falta para resolver el problema? Es necesario conocer la tasa de cambio actual entre el dólar y el peso colombiano. Esta información puede obtenerse de fuentes confiables, como bancos o sitios web financieros ALGORITMO : Calcular la cantidad de dólares equivalentes a una cantidad de pesos colombianos INICIO 1. INGRESAR PRECIO DEL DÓLAR 2. INGRESAR EL TOTAL DE PESOS COLOMBIANOS 3. REALIZAR EL CALCULO DEL TOTAL DE DOLARES , DIVIDENDO EL TOTAL DE PESOS ENTRE EL PRECIO DEL DÓLAR INGRESADO 4. PRESENTAR LOS RESULTADOS AL USUARIO FIN 2. Se desea elaborar un algoritmo que permita determinar la temperatura equivalente en grados centígrados a la cantidad de grados Fahrenheit actuales en la ciudad de New York. Información importante y necesaria: La temperatura actual en grados Fahrenheit en la ciudad de Nueva York. Información que se puede prescindir: Cualquier información adicional que no esté relacionada con la conversión de grados Fahrenheit a grados centígrados. Datos de entrada conocidos: La temperatura en grados Fahrenheit en la ciudad de Nueva York. Incógnita o qué debemos calcular: La temperatura equivalente en grados centígrados. Agrupación de datos en categorías: No es necesario agrupar los datos en categorías en este caso, ya que solo se necesita una temperatura en grados Fahrenheit como entrada. Información adicional necesaria: La fórmula de conversión de grados Fahrenheit a grados centígrados. Celsius = ( Fahrenheit – 32) x 5/9 ALGORITMO: CONVERTIR GRADOS FAHRENHEIT A CELSIUS INICIO 1. INGRESAR GRADOS FAHRENHEIT 2. INGRESAR FORMULA 3. REALIZAR EL CALCULO DE LA FORMULA = ( Fahrenheit – 32) x 5/9 4. PRESENTAR LOS RESULTADOS AL USUARIO. FIN SUPONIENDO QUE NOS ENCONTRAMOS DESCANSANDO EN UNA NUESTRA CASA EN UNA CIUDAD DE COLOMBIA REQUIERO HACER UN PLAN DETALLADO PARA LLEGAR A TIEMPO A MI SITIO DE TRABAJO EL DÍA SIGUIENTE. Información importante y necesaria: Distancia o tiempo de lejanía del lugar , hora de entrada Información que se puede prescindir: Cualquier información adicional que no esté relacionada al plan Datos de entrada conocidos: Se encuentra en una ciudad de Colombia Incógnita o qué debemos calcular: Llegar a tiempo al sitio de trabajo Agrupación de datos en categorías: Distancia en kilómetros Tiempo en horas o minutos de distancia Información adicional necesaria: Uso de vehículo Uso de motocicleta A pie ALGORTIMO : PLAN DETALLADO LLEGAR A TIEMPO AL TRABAJO. INICIO 1. DEFINIR HORA DE ENTRADA AL TRABAJO 2. DEFINIR TIEMPO DEL VIAJE 3. PREPARACION PERSONAL ( TIEMPO) 4. TIEMPO ADICIONAL 5. DEFINIR HORA DE DESPERTAR 6. DEFINIR HORA DE SALIDA DE LA CASA 7. DEFINIR KILOMETROOS DE DISTANCIA 8. DEFINIR VELOCIDAD A LA QUE VAMOS 9. DEFINIR TIEMPO RESTANTE 10. CALCULAR LAS DISTANCIA EN KLM POR EL TIEMPO …..FIN ( Para calcular la distancia recorrida en un cierto tiempo si conoces la velocidad, puedes usar la fórmula básica de la física) = Distancia=Velocidad×Tiempo Donde: • • • La distancia se mide en kilómetros (km), La velocidad se mide en kilómetros por hora (km/h), y El tiempo se mide en horas (h). Por ejemplo, si viajas a una velocidad constante de 60 km/h durante 2 horas, la distancia que recorrerías sería: Distancia=60km/h×2h=120km Por lo tanto, habrías recorrido 120 kilómetros. SUPONIENDO QUE TENGO HABILIDADES EN LA ELABORACIÓN DE COMIDA NECESITO ELABORAR UN ARROZ CON POLLO PARA 5 PERSONAS. Información importante y necesaria: 5 personas Información que se puede prescindir: Cualquier información adicional que no esté relacionada al plan edad, sexo etc Datos de entrada conocidos: Arroz con pollo, 5 personas Incógnita o qué debemos calcular: Cuanta cantidad de alimento se va o el valor de esta Agrupación de datos en categorías: Valor de los ingredientes Cantidad de ingredientes Información adicional necesaria: Costo de los productos ALGORITMO : Elaborar un arroz con pollo para 5 personas . INICIO. 1. 2. 3. 4. 5. 6. 7. 8. FIN Arroz con pollo Cantidad de personas Ingredientes necesarios Valor de cada producto Cantidad de producto Instrucciones Tiempo de cocción Repartir en cantidad igual a las 5 personas 3. Elabore una investigación corta usando los materiales disponibles en la biblioteca o Internet respecto a los fundamentos para la resolución de problemas con algoritmos, seleccione por lo menos tres fuentes que le permitan resolver las siguientes preguntas: ● Definición de diagrama de flujo. ● Símbolos más importantes. ● Seleccionar uno de los problemas de la sección 1 y representarlo en su equivalente diagrama de flujo. Definición de Diagrama de Flujo: Un diagrama de flujo es una representación gráfica de un proceso o algoritmo que se utiliza comúnmente en la programación y la resolución de problemas. Se compone de una serie de símbolos y conectores que representan las acciones, decisiones, entradas y salidas en un proceso. Los diagramas de flujo ayudan a visualizar y comprender la secuencia de pasos necesarios para realizar una tarea o resolver un problema. SIMBOLOS MAS IMPORTANTES https://concepto.de/diagrama-de-flujo/ SELECCIONAR UNO DE LOS PROBLEMAS DE LA SECCIÓN REPRESENTARLO EN SU EQUIVALENTE DIAGRAMA DE FLUJO. 1 Y PROBLEMA ESCOGIDO : Se desea elaborar un algoritmo que permita identificar la cantidad de dólares equivalentes a una cantidad de pesos colombianos. DIAGRAMA DE FLUJO : INICIO VALOR DEL DÓLAR CANTIDAD PESOS COLOMBIANOS CANTIADAD DE PESOS / PRECIO DEL DÓLAR INGRESADO RESULTADO EN DÓLARES FIN